Research Abstract

Electrical tinnitus suppressor, which was developed by the Hokkaido University, was implanted to two female and one male tinnitus patients. Electrical tinnitus suppressor consists of a portable electrical stimulator, the first coil inside the hearing aids plastic case and the second coil implanted in the mastoid. The stimulus frequency was 10kHz sinusoidal wave. The auditory nerve is able to be stimulated at home twice.
The coil covered with silicone was implanted in the mastoid following mastoidectomy using the postauricular incision. Stimulating Pt-Ir ball electrode covered with polyalcholic gel was placed on the promontory and indifferent electrode was fixd to the subcutaneous tissue at the tip of mastoid.
Outcome of tinnitus using implanted tinnitus suppressor
In case 1, tinnitus was suppressed completely for four hours following promontory stimulation in our clinics before using the device and moderate relief was maintained for a day. She did not almost experience tinnitus all day long after the induction of the device in spite of two times usage. Nowadays no tinnitus was perceived following only once at night.
In case 2, tinnitus was suppressed completely for a day and moderate relief was mainteined for a few days with promontory stimulation in our clinics before using the device. Following the induction of the device in spite of two times usage she also did not almost experience tinnitus all day long.
In case 3, nowadays no tinnitus was perceived following only once at night.
